Ethanol extraction from fresh new plant elements include massive quantities of drinking water, that will even be extracted in to the ethanol.

Making perfumes through reverse engineering with analytical tactics which include Fuel chromatography–mass spectrometry (GC/MS) can expose the "typical" click here formula for any certain perfume. The difficulty of GC/MS analysis arises mainly because of the complexity of the perfume's substances. This is especially because of the presence of all-natural essential oils along with other components consisting of sophisticated chemical mixtures.

Enfleurage: Absorption of aroma components into stable Body fat or wax after which extraction of odorous oils with ethyl Liquor. Extraction by enfleurage was usually utilized when distillation was not possible for the reason that some fragrant compounds denature by means of substantial heat.

One of the most generally utilized courses of synthetic aromatics by far would be the white musks. These materials are present in all sorts of business perfumes as a neutral history to the center notes.
